How To Fix SO378 - List <&> cannot be included. &


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: SO - SAPoffice: message texts

  • Message number: 378

  • Message text: List <&> cannot be included. &

    The SAP error message SO378 typically indicates that there is an issue with including a specific list in a document or report. The message format usually looks like this: "List <&> cannot be included. &", where the placeholders represent specific details about the list that cannot be included.

    Cause:

    The error can occur due to several reasons, including:

    1. List Format Issues: The list you are trying to include may not be in the correct format or may not meet the requirements set by the SAP system.
    2.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ary permissions to access or include the specified list.
    3. Data Integrity Issues: There may be inconsistencies or errors in the data that the list is based on, preventing it from being included.
    4. Technical Limitations: There may be system limitations or bugs that prevent the list from being processed correctly.

    Solution:

    To resolve the SO378 error, you can try the following steps:

    1. Check List Format: Ensure that the list you are trying to include is in the correct format and meets all the necessary criteria.
    2. Review Authorizations: Verify that you have the appropriate authorizations to include the list. If not, contact your system administrator to obtain the necessary permissions.
    3. Validate Data: Check the data associated with the list for any inconsistencies or errors. Correct any issues found.
    4.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idelines on including lists in the context you are working in.
    5. System Logs: Check system logs for any additional error messages or warnings that may provide more context about the issue.
    6.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to SAP support for further assistance, especially if it appears to be a technical limitation or bug.
